How Reliable is the MG Zr?

Based on 651,705 MOT tests across 53,026 vehicles.

69.8%
Pass Rate
6,146
Miles/Year
25
Year Lifespan
53,026
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 31,258
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 23,242
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 22,215
Stop lamp not working 16,145
Exhaust has a major leak of exhaust gases 15,953

YS52 WGD is a 2002 MG Zr in Grey with a 1,396c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.2%.

Across all 2002 MG Zr models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.9% with a typical mileage of 61,756 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a MG Zr f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,258 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YS52 WGD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The MG Zr typ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 24 years old, this MG Zr is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
